Finding Inner Peace: Combating Mental Stress through Indian Lifestyle and Hindu Rituals

In today's fast-paced world, mental stress has become a common companion in our lives. The demands of modern life often lead to anxiety, depression, and various other mental health issues. However, the rich tapestry of Indian lifestyle and Hindu rituals offers a valuable perspective on how to overcome stress, attain inner peace, and foster a harmonious society. In this article, we will explore how traditional Indian wisdom can guide us towards a balanced and stress-free life, ultimately leading to a more considerate and cleaner society.




Yoga and Meditation

Yoga and meditation, integral parts of Indian culture, have been proven to be effective in managing stress. Practicing yoga asanas and meditation techniques help in calming the mind, reducing anxiety, and improving overall well-being. Taking a few moments each day to engage in these practices can go a long way in maintaining mental equilibrium.

Ayurveda and Healthy Living

Ayurveda, India's ancient system of medicine, focuses on balancing the body and mind. By following Ayurvedic principles, we can choose a diet and lifestyle that suits our unique constitution. Eating fresh, locally sourced, and seasonal foods, as advocated by Ayurveda, not only promotes physical health but also contributes to mental well-being.



Connecting with Nature

Hindu rituals often involve connecting with nature. Regular visits to temples, where devotees are surrounded by lush gardens and serene surroundings, provide a sense of tranquility. Additionally, sacred rivers like the Ganges offer spiritual cleansing and an opportunity to connect with nature. Spending time in natural settings is a powerful way to alleviate stress.



Mindfulness and Gratitude

Indian culture emphasizes the importance of being mindful and showing gratitude for what we have. By focusing on the present moment and appreciating life's blessings, we can reduce stress and increase our overall happiness. Hindu rituals often incorporate gratitude as part of prayers and offerings.



Community and Social Support

Indian society places great importance on community and social support systems. Engaging with friends, family, and the local community can be a strong antidote to mental stress. Through social interactions, we can share our concerns, find support, and establish a sense of belonging.



Cleanliness and Respect

Maintaining a clean and tidy environment is deeply rooted in Indian values. By respecting our surroundings and keeping them clean, we not only promote physical hygiene but also contribute to mental well-being. A clutter-free environment can help alleviate stress and create a more peaceful atmosphere.



Language and Communication

Being mindful of the language we use is essential in creating a harmonious society. Speaking respectfully and using native languages when appropriate fosters better understanding and empathy among individuals. In professional settings, using a common language, such as English, helps maintain a productive and respectful atmosphere.



Safe Driving and Considerate Behavior

Responsible and safe driving is an essential aspect of a well-functioning society. Using blinkers and yielding when needed shows consideration for fellow drivers, pedestrians, and the environment. Practicing patience and politeness on the road reduces stress and enhances road safety.



Combating mental stress and promoting a better society is a shared responsibility. The Indian lifestyle and Hindu rituals offer valuable insights into living a stress-free life and fostering a more considerate and cleaner society. By incorporating practices such as yoga, meditation, Ayurveda, and mindfulness, and by embracing principles of cleanliness, respect, and responsible behavior, we can create a society that prioritizes the well-being of all its members. Ultimately, by living these principles, we can find inner peace and contribute to a more harmonious and stress-free world.
